Numerical Simulation Study on Fish Habitats in the Downstream Section of Yangqu Hydropower Station. [PDF]

open access: yesEcol Evol
Study on fish habitats in the downstream river of Yangqu Hydropower Station found that high‐quality habitats are most sensitive to flow changes. The most suitable ecological flow range is 600–1150 m3/s, vital for maintaining ecological stability and fish conservation in the Yellow River.

Analysis of wave clipping effects of plain reservoir artificial islands based on MIKE21 SW model

open access: yesWater Science and Engineering, 2019
Plain reservoirs are shallow, and have low dams and widespread water surfaces. Therefore, wind-wave-induced damage to the dam is one of the important factors affecting the safety of the reservoir.
